Fields of Application
and Conveyed Fluids
EDUR-self-priming centrifugal
pumps are mainly used within
water and wastewater
technology, general industrial technology as
well as in
liquefied gas applications.In contrast to
non-self-priming pumps, self-priming centrifugal pumps are
able
to ventilate the suction line and to self-prim lower-lying liquids.
Also
gas-emitting fluids can be supplied
reliably. The pumps stand out due to
low
suction times and
high efficiency grades to
guarantee reliable operation. Special characteristics are also the high air
flow rate and wear resistance.Self-priming pumps from EDUR
are suitable for the supply of
slightly contaminated water,
cooling water, emulsions, oils and fuels such as
kerosene, petrol and diesel.

Technical data
Flow
rate: max. 300 m³/h
Head:
max. 165 m
Permissible
operating pressure: up to 16 bar
Temperature:
-40 °C up to +110 °C
Viscosity:
up to 200 mm²/s
